SMMIX vs. IVNQX
Compare and contrast key facts about Invesco Summit Fund (SMMIX) and Invesco Nasdaq 100 Index Fund (IVNQX).
SMMIX is managed by Invesco. It was launched on Nov 1, 1982. IVNQX is managed by Invesco. It was launched on Oct 13, 2020.

Correlation
The correlation between SMMIX and IVNQX is 0.95,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.
